CBD Pet Products: One of the Biggest Trends in Pet Care for 2019

CBD pet products

More and more cannabis companies are looking to develop CBD pet products and for good reason, considering the pet industry is worth an estimated $72 billion. What’s more, the CBD pet market is projected to be among the fastest growing CBD sectors.

The prevalence of CBD pet products in the market became evident at this year’s Global Pet Expo 2019, with every row of exhibitors including at least one company promoting CBD products for pets.

From pet food additives to CBD salves, the variety of CBD pet products hitting the market seems limitless.

Benefits of CBD Pet Products

As mentioned, CBD pet products claim to offer a ton of benefits to animals, from reducing pain and inflammation to improving appetite and skin health.

While there hasn’t been a lot of research related to the effects CBD has on pets, a study from last year revealed very positive results.

The study, which was published by Frontiers in Veterinary Science in 2018, studied the effects of CBD oil on 22 client-owned dogs with osteoarthritis. The clinical tests were very positive, with 80% of the dogs showing a significant decrease in pain and an increase in mobility.

Now that CBD is federally legal in the United States following the passing of the US Farm Bill, researchers will be able to conduct more studies around the effects of CBD on both humans and pets.

Interestingly, many of the studies that back CBD, such as the topical treatment of CBD for arthritic pain and inflammation in humans are performed on animals (rats) and produced no side effects. The FDA-approved Epidiolex, which is the first-ever CBD medicine for the treatment of seizures and epilepsy, was also tested on rats and rabbits, with the only side effect being related to pregnancy on a very high dose.

Still, regardless of the lack of scientific backing, more and more pet owners are turning to CBD pet products to help with ailments. Ultimately, the safety of CBD for pets comes down to dosage. Although safe dosages have yet to be determined, many CBD pet products offer dosing guidelines that are typically related to the animal’s weight.

California is the only state so far to approve a bill that allows veterinarians to discuss the therapeutic use of cannabis for pets, although they are still prohibited from prescribing it. Of course, this doesn’t mean that vets in other areas can’t talk about CBD pet products with their clients, but it does put them at risk of penalty.
